引言
随着大数据和人工智能技术的飞速发展,大模型预测框架在各个领域得到了广泛应用。这些框架能够处理海量数据,提供精确的预测结果,帮助企业做出更加明智的决策。本文将深入探讨大模型预测框架的核心组成部分和构建高效预测系统的秘诀。
数据处理与特征工程
数据采集
- 数据源选择:根据预测目标选择合适的数据源,包括历史数据、实时数据等。
- 数据整合:将不同来源的数据进行整合,形成统一的数据集。
特征提取
- 特征选择:通过相关性分析、信息增益等方法,选择对预测结果影响较大的特征。
- 特征构造:根据业务需求,构造新的特征,提高预测精度。
数据归一化
- Min-Max标准化:将特征值缩放到[0, 1]区间,优化算法性能。
- Z-score标准化:消除量纲影响,使不同特征的权重均衡。
模型构建
神经网络结构设计
- 输入层:根据特征数量设计输入层。
- 隐藏层:根据模型复杂度,设计多个隐藏层,每个隐藏层包含多个神经元。
- 输出层:根据预测目标,设计输出层,如分类任务的softmax层,回归任务的线性层。
模型训练
- 损失函数选择:根据预测目标,选择合适的损失函数,如交叉熵损失、均方误差等。
- 优化算法:采用梯度下降、Adam等优化算法,提高模型收敛速度。
- 正则化:使用L1、L2正则化等方法,防止过拟合。
算法实现与优化
算法实现
- 深度学习框架:使用TensorFlow、PyTorch等深度学习框架进行模型实现。
- 并行计算:利用GPU、多核CPU等硬件资源,提高计算效率。
优化策略
- 数据增强:通过数据变换、扩充等方法,增加数据多样性。
- 超参数调整:根据模型表现,调整学习率、批大小等超参数。
- 模型集成:结合多个模型,提高预测精度。
评估与优化
评估指标
- 准确率:衡量模型预测正确率。
- 召回率:衡量模型对正例的识别能力。
- F1值:综合考虑准确率和召回率,平衡模型性能。
优化方法
- 交叉验证:通过交叉验证,评估模型在不同数据集上的表现。
- 参数调优:使用网格搜索、贝叶斯优化等方法,寻找最佳参数组合。
总结
大模型预测框架在构建高效预测系统中扮演着重要角色。通过合理的数据处理、模型构建、算法实现与优化,可以有效地提高预测精度,为业务决策提供有力支持。在实际应用中,应根据具体场景和需求,不断调整和优化模型,以实现最佳预测效果。
